What is mass defect (Δm)?

Back

Mass defect is the difference between the mass of an atomic nucleus and the sum of the masses of its individual protons and neutrons.

What is binding energy?

Back

Binding energy is the energy required to disassemble a nucleus into its constituent protons and neutrons, equivalent to the mass defect.

What is the formula for calculating mass defect?

Back

Δm = (Zmp + Nmn) - mnucleus where Z is the number of protons and N is the number of neutrons.

How is binding energy related to mass defect?

Back

Binding energy is directly proportional to mass defect, as described by Einstein's equation E=mc².
